New Hope Properties Face Unique Hardscape Challenges — Here’s What’s Behind Them
New Hope’s setting along the Delaware River is exactly what makes it one of Bucks County’s most sought-after communities — and what makes outdoor hardscape and landscape work particularly demanding here. Properties along the river corridor deal with higher-than-average soil moisture, significant slope variation, and the constant interaction of surface water, groundwater, and clay-heavy soil. The result is a predictable set of outdoor problems that affects both historic in-town properties and newer homes throughout the surrounding Solebury Township area.
Retaining walls are a particular challenge in New Hope because many properties rely on walls to manage grade changes — and walls built without proper drainage behind them fail reliably within a few winters. Patios and walkways face the same freeze-thaw pressure that affects all of Bucks County, but with the added moisture load of being near the Delaware River making conditions more severe.

Why Hardscape Work Fails in New Hope’s River Corridor
New Hope’s proximity to the Delaware River and Solebury Township create a combination of soil moisture levels, slope conditions, and drainage demands that punish improperly installed outdoor work. What Paz Landscaping finds on New Hope properties:
Retaining walls failing from hydrostatic pressure buildup — river-adjacent soil stays saturated longer, multiplying freeze-thaw damage
Paver patios developing severe unevenness on sloped properties where base material migrates downhill over time
Walkways on terraced New Hope properties heaving from frost and becoming safety hazards within a season or two of installation
Drainage problems funneling toward historic and older in-town foundations not designed for modern water volumes
Sloped landscape beds eroding and losing material when proper terracing and retaining structures aren't in place
Temporary repairs on New Hope properties fail because the river-adjacent soil conditions and topographic demands require engineering solutions, not surface patches. Every hardscape installation here starts with drainage and grading analysis.
